SEATTLE (AP) — The US national team advanced to the knockout round at the FIFA World Cup despite the absence of injured forward Christian Pulisic, after defeating Australia 2-0 yesterday.A deep US roster overcame Pulisic’s absence to clinch a knockout berth after only two matches for the first time. The last time the Americans served as World Cup hosts in 1994, they advanced by being one of the best third-place teams. They then lost to eventual champions Brazil in their next match, which was in the round of 16.
